摘要: 为了评估七星瓢虫Coccinella septempunctata对重大入侵害虫草地贪夜蛾Spodoptera frugiperda(J.E.Smith)的防控效果,本试验在室内条件下开展了七星瓢虫对草地贪夜蛾1龄、2龄幼虫的捕食功能反应和种内干扰研究。结果表明:七星瓢虫对草地贪夜蛾幼虫的捕食功能反应均符合HollingⅡ模型,七星瓢虫对草地贪夜蛾1龄幼虫的日最大捕食量、瞬时攻击率和处理时间分别为233.100头、1.204和0.103 h;对草地贪夜蛾2龄幼虫的日最大捕食量、瞬时攻击率和处理时间分别为41.220头、1.075和0.582 h。七星瓢虫的搜寻效应随猎物密度的增加而逐渐降低。七星瓢虫对草地贪夜蛾的捕食作用受到较强的种内干扰。试验证明七星瓢虫对草地贪夜蛾具有较好的控害效果,可用于对草地贪夜蛾的防控实践。

Abstract: To evaluate the control potential of Coccinella septempunctata adults on the 1st instar and 2nd instar larvae of Spodoptera frugiperda (J. E. Smith), the functional responses and mutual interference of C. septempunctata were studied in laboratory. The results showed that the maximum daily predation amount, the sequence of attacking efficiency and the handling time C. septempunctata adults on the 1st instars of S. frugiperda were 233.1, 1.204 and 0.103 h, respectively; and the values on the 2nd instars of S. frugiperda were 41.2, 1.075 and 0.582 h, respectively. The C. septempunctata adults gradually reduced their search activities as the density of prey increases. The predation of C. septempunctata was strongly affected by intraspecific interference. This study proves that C. septempunctata adults are efficient for the control of S. frugiperda and can be used in biological control of S. frugiperda in field.
